Named by the New York Times as the “father of near death experiences,” Raymond Moody, MD, PhD, best-selling author of the seminal work, Life After Life, explores the provocative and intriguing question, “Is it possible to share a loved one’s passing from this world to the next?” Dr, Moody completely changed the way we view death and dying. His most recent research offers a scientific model for how “shared-death experiences” can actually happen. Dr, Moody reveals compelling evidence of people sharing their loved ones’ first moments of their journey from this life to the next, including a wide range of case studies and his personal experiences during his own mother’s passing. He offers comfort and hope, and sheds new light on the mysterious adventure we take at life’s end. Dr. Moody continues to capture enormous public interest and generate controversy with his ground-breaking work on the near-death experience and what happens when we die. An Award-Winning Author. Dr. Moody received the World Humanitarian Award in Denmark in 1988. He was also honored with a bronze medal in the Human Relations category at the New York Film Festival for the movie version of Life After Life. A World-Renowned Scholar and Researcher. Dr. Moody is the leading authority on the 'near-death experience'—a phrase he coined in the late seventies.

Except from the Barnes & Noble “Meet The Writer” Interview with Jack Canfield.
Q: What was the book that most influenced your life or your career as a writer?
A: Life After Life by Dr. Raymond Moody. I have a whole chapter on how this book changed my life in my book You've Got to Read This Book!

“The most impactful part was that almost all people reporting these experiences were asked two questions by the spiritual being they met; “How have you expanded your capacity to love?" and "What wisdom have you gained from your experience?"
When I first read this book while in graduate school back in 1971, I decided to devote my life to studying these two areas and teaching others what I learned in regard to how to be more loving and how to gain wisdom from our lives and the lives of others. This is what has led to the Chicken Soup for the Soul books and my books on how to live more successful lives”.
